Orchidectomy) is a Male-to-Female Surgery procedure that removes the testicles. Orchiectomy results in sterility, and can reduce sex drive and male secondary characteristics, such as beard growth, due to the loss of testosterone. Many trans women choose to have this procedure and no further GRS, such as Vaginoplasty.
